More information on Byron Hotel
The Byron is located in the very convenient and cosmopolitan area of Hyde Park and Bayswater. This makes it ideally situated for your visit to London, be it business or pleasure. With good access to all public transport facilities, The Byron is a perfect base from which to explore London. Up to 123 different locations in London are put within easy reach by the 2 metro stations near the hotel.Originally two Victorian houses, and recently refurbished. The Byron has been professionally designed to provide modern standards of comfort in traditional surroundings whilst maintaining a country house atmosphere. The professionally trained staff will ensure that your stay with us will be a complete and memorable experience.The hotel amenities are: airport transfer, bar, concierge, Internet access-high speed, Internet access-wireless, lift/elevator, lobby, non-smoking rooms, reception, restaurant, safe deposit box, smoke free hotel.
